DIY Jewelry Dish

Happy Monday! I hope everyone had a great weekend. I spent a relaxing one with my family in Florida watching the Olympics and crafting with my mom...perfect!


Over the weekend, I made this little guy to hold my bracelets:
I found the idea here. You'll need a dish (I got a plastic one from the dollar store), acrylic paint, painters tape, Mod Podge, and a paint pen.

Paint two layers with Mod Podge before each layer. In hindsight, I would've left out the Mod Podge between the first and second layers because I think it led to a snag I hit at the end.

I traced my first initial from an "E" that I printed on regular paper using pencil, and then went over it in silver paint pen.

Mod Podge over the top layer once it's dry. I would recommend taking the paint off a little before it's dry. As I took mine off, the paint pulled really bad. It ended up looking OK, but I was hoping for a smooth line.

Finished product with a few bangles.
